▶ Bidirectional Streaming Labs

Bidirectional Streaming Labs

WebSocket frames, HTTP/2 multiplexing, HOL blocking, SSE, reconnect.

5Interactive labs
100%Single-file HTML
Interactive labs

All 5 labs in this category

Advertisement
LAB · 01

Head-of-Line Blocking — TCP vs QUIC

Drop one packet; see how HTTP/2 stalls while HTTP/3 doesn't.

Open lab
LAB · 02

HTTP/2 Stream Multiplexing

Multiple streams interleave over one connection.

Open lab
LAB · 03

Reconnect with Exponential Backoff

When the connection drops, retry with increasing delays + jitter.

Open lab
LAB · 04

Server-Sent Events (SSE)

Server-push one-way stream over HTTP.

Open lab
LAB · 05

WebSocket Frame Flow

Animate frames flowing between client and server.

Open lab